Srinagar : Police on Wednesday said that it has attached a single-story residential house valued at ₹15,44,523, with a plinth area of 1258 sq. ft. under Survey No. 498 min, belonging to Mukhtar Ahmad Naikoo R/o Meemander in Shopian.
According to a police statement issued here on Wednesday the property has been found to be acquired using money obtained through the sale of illegal drugs and narcotics as the accused has been previously involved in multiple NDPS cases, including FIR No. 41/2016 and FIR No. 27/2020 of Police Station Shopian.
The attachment process was executed in the presence of a duly constituted police team, Executive Magistrate, Lambardar, and Chowkidar, ensuring full compliance with all legal protocols. In its statement police reiterated its commitment to enforce the law against narcotics-related offences and appealed people to report any information regarding drug-related activities.
